QuizUp

less
QuizUp was a popular mobile trivia game launched in 2013, allowing players to compete against friends and opponents worldwide in a wide range of topics. Players could choose from thousands of categories, including history, science, pop culture, and more, testing their knowledge in real-time matches. The game featured a user-friendly interface, social integration, and leaderboards, fostering a competitive yet fun environment. With its engaging gameplay and community-driven content, QuizUp quickly gained a dedicated following, making it one of the leading trivia apps before its eventual shutdown in 2020. Despite its closure, the game left a lasting impact on the trivia gaming landscape.

Trivia Crack

less
Trivia Crack is a popular mobile trivia game that challenges players' knowledge across various categories, including history, science, art, entertainment, and sports. Released in 2013 by Etermax, the game allows users to compete against friends or random opponents in a race to answer questions and collect character cards representing different categories. With its vibrant graphics, engaging gameplay, and a vast database of questions, Trivia Crack appeals to trivia enthusiasts of all ages. Players can also participate in tournaments and daily challenges, making it a fun and interactive way to test and expand their knowledge while enjoying friendly competition.

Kahoot!

less
Kahoot! is an interactive learning platform designed to engage users through game-based learning. Founded in 2013, it allows educators, students, and organizations to create and participate in quizzes, surveys, and discussions in a fun, competitive format. Users can access a vast library of pre-made games or create their own, making it ideal for classrooms, corporate training, and social gatherings. Kahoot! promotes collaboration and active participation, enhancing the learning experience and making it enjoyable. With its accessible interface and mobile compatibility, Kahoot! has become a popular tool for educators worldwide, transforming traditional learning into an engaging, interactive adventure.

Quizlet

less
Quizlet is a versatile online learning platform designed to enhance study and educational experiences through interactive tools. Founded in 2005, it allows users to create, share, and discover flashcards, quizzes, and games tailored to various subjects and learning styles. With features like study sets, learning modes, and collaborative tools, Quizlet caters to students, educators, and lifelong learners alike. The platform supports a wide range of content, making it suitable for diverse educational needs, from language learning to exam preparation. Its user-friendly interface and mobile accessibility empower learners to study anytime, anywhere, fostering a more engaging and effective learning environment.

HQ Trivia

less
HQ Trivia was a live trivia game show launched in 2017 that captivated audiences with its interactive format. Players participated via a mobile app, answering a series of multiple-choice questions in real-time for a chance to win cash prizes. The show featured charismatic hosts and created a sense of community as players engaged with one another during live broadcasts. Its innovative approach combined elements of gaming and entertainment, quickly gaining popularity and attracting millions of players. Although it faced challenges and eventually ceased operations, HQ Trivia remains a notable example of how technology can transform traditional quiz formats into engaging experiences.

Brainly

less
Brainly is a collaborative online learning platform that connects students and educators, allowing them to ask and answer academic questions in a supportive community. Founded in 2009, it has grown into one of the largest educational networks, with millions of users worldwide. Brainly covers a wide range of subjects, including math, science, history, and language arts, making it a valuable resource for students seeking help with homework or studying. The platform encourages peer-to-peer interaction, fostering a sense of collaboration and engagement in the learning process. Additionally, Brainly offers features such as moderation to ensure quality and accuracy in responses.
